Lot 162
Multi-coloured Coral, Black Diamond and Diamond 'Panda' Brooch/Pendant, Wang Chin-lin
HK$48,000

Modelled as a floating panda with balloons, the balloons set with multi-coloured corals measuring approximately 16.50 x 10.39 x 9.00 to 12.87 x 9.46 x 3.80mm, the panda decorated with circular-cut black diamonds and brilliant-cut diamonds together weighing approximately 2.15 carats, mounted in 14 karat blackened, pink and white gold, signed.
Accompanied by an original signed box.

Wang Chinlin is the recipient of many jewellery design awards in the Greater China region in recent years, including the gold medal for baroque pearl design in the first China International Pearl Jewellery Design Competition in 2016 and the first runner-up in the Open Group of International Design Competition on Trendy Fei Cui Jewellery in 2017. After graduated from National Taiwan University of Arts, Wang Chin-Lin set up her own jewellery studio in 2005. Since then, her works has been showcased with other jewellery designers in Beijing, Shanghai, Shenzhen and Taipei, gaining a wide acceptance amongst connoisseurs across the region.

To be presented by Tiancheng International are two charming panda brooches/ pendants (Lot 161 and 162) from Wang’s “Panda” series created in 2018.

Whether it be modelled as a floating panda with balloons or a swinging panda in a bamboo groove, Wang skillfully portrays pandas Tuan Tuan and Yuan Yuan that are housed at Taipei Zoo in a lifelike way.
